Playing CDs
Shuffle Play on one disc
You can play all tracks on the specific disc in a random order.
1Press SHUFFLE repeatedly until “1 DISC” appears in the display.
2Press DISC 1 – 5 to start 1 DISC Shuffle Play on
the selected disc.
The indication appears while the player is “shuffling” the tracks.
To cancel Shuffle Play
Press CONTINUE.
You can start Shuffle Play while playing
Press SHUFFLE, and Shuffle Play starts from the current track.
You can arrange the order of the tracks on the discs and create your own program. The program can contain up to 32 “steps” — one “step” may contain a track or a whole disc.

1Press PROGRAM.
“PROGRAM” appears in the display.
If a program is already stored, the last step of the program appears in the display. When you want to erase the whole program, hold down CLEAR until “ALL CLr” appears in the display (see page 13).
2Press DISC 1 – 5 to select the disc.

“AL” in the display stands for “all” tracks.
When you want to program the whole disc as one step, skip Steps 3 to 4, and go to Step 5.
3Turn AMS ±until the track number you want appears in the display.
The track number being programmed flashes and the total playing time including the track appears in the display.
